We are looking for a curious and motivated Threat Intelligence Security Engineer to join the Security Operations Analytics and Automation Team. The Analytics and Automation Team supports Gartner’s Security Operations Center in proactive creation of detection and mitigation content – in addition to providing ad hoc incident response support as needed. Additionally, the team works closely with key resources throughout Gartner IT to support secure applications/solutions/platforms, build context-aware threat models for existing applications, and partner with teams on strategic remediation initiatives to continuously improve Gartner’s security posture. 

What you will do

  • Conduct ‘tactical’ threat intelligence operations - support threat hunt ideas and thesis
  • Track cyber threats and generate intelligence reports and tippers to help better protect the business.
  • Produce periodic intelligence reports to provide situational awareness to key stakeholders.
  • Build and implement tools to automate security monitoring and tasks.
  • Develop innovative and cutting-edge detection content aligned with ATT&CK, Cyber Kill Chain, and various other cyber security frameworks.
  • Work with key stakeholders to identify, respond to, and remediate information security issues.
  • Contribute ideas and solutions to a fast-paced, growing, and evolving team centered around operational excellence.
  • Assist with developing solutions to help mitigate security vulnerabilities quickly and efficiently.
  • Assist with investigations of security events and incidents.
  • Hunt for evil, misconfigurations, and other anomalous activity

What you will need 

Ideal candidates have 2-4yrs of experience in a Threat Intelligence role or similar experience within a Security Operations Center (SOC), while also demonstrating critical thinking and effective written and oral communications. Candidates should have strong problem-solving skills along and the ability to consistently evaluate and reprioritize tasks based on the current operation picture. 

Must have

  • Curiosity
  • Comfortable writing and editing various product types such as INTSUMS, ad hoc reporting and briefings.
  • Ability to work autonomously.
  • Capability to distill complex topics into meaningful products suited to a wide variety of audiences from SOC engineers to executives.
  • Familiar with various intel tools and methods (TIPs, DB’s, OSINT, DDW)
  • Familiar with intel frameworks such as MITRE ATT&CK

Nice to have. 

  • Previous red/purple team experience (practical or lab based)
  • Previous threat hunting experience
  • Experience triaging, investigating, and remediating security events and incidents.
  • Cloud experience (AWS, Azure, GCP)
  • Experience developing detections (SIEM, YARA, IDS/IPS, etc.)
